# Tokens are single-use, expire after 15 minutes, and are hashed
# before storage — never log the raw token. Rate limiting: 3 reset
# requests per account per hour, enforced in the gateway, not here.
# Email templates live in the templates repo; this service only
# emits events. Old flow endpoints are deprecated but still routed
# until Q3 cleanup. Token records are stored in the auth database,
# reachable via the connection string that follows.

replica DSN, tawef-hahap: mysql://eliix_svc:FiIC0jz@db-394a.lumiclabs.internal:5432/holius

Leadership Review Briefing — Finance Team. The proposed Meridel Plus subscription tier bundles analytics, priority support, and expanded storage at a mid-market price point. Modeling by the revenue group projects breakeven at roughly 4,200 subscribers within three quarters, assuming churn stays under 6%. Pricing sensitivity tests continue this month. The confidential commercial rationale is appended directly below for your review.

internal memo for tajof-kaduf: Only 65 of the 511 pilot accounts renewed Lamdor, so a churn review is set for January 26. Aldmirek Works is in early talks to buy Alddorox Works for about $490.9 million.

Revised go-live is now mid-Q4. Budget impact is limited to contractor extensions, estimated at a 9% overrun against the original envelope. Marta Veylin's team has absorbed testing costs within existing allocations. No change to depreciation schedules is expected this quarter. The steering group has also agreed on the following direction for next year's roadmap.

management briefing: Project Ulavan slips by two quarters because of the staffing delay.